三名联邦保守党议员”跳槽”是政治格局的必然(观点,中英对照)

在正常的政治时期,一名国会议员“跳槽”会被视为”背叛”。但在非常时期,政治“跳槽”往往是经过审慎考量的选择。

In normal political times, when a Member of Parliament crosses the floor, the story is about betrayal. In serious times, it is about judgment.

三名保守党议员已跨越党派阵营,加入总理卡尼领导的自由党。保守党领袖皮埃尔·博励治将此举斥为“幕后交易”。但这样的说法却忽略了加拿大当下面临的更深层现实。

Three Conservative MPs have now left their party to join Prime Minister Mark Carney’s Liberal caucus. Their decisions have been framed by Pierre Poilievre as “dirty backroom deals.” But that language ignores the larger context Canada finds itself in.

在国家面连严峻考验的关头,这绝非一次寻常的议会人员变动。

This is not a routine parliamentary shuffle. This is a moment of national vulnerability.

过去数月来,加拿大一直承受来自美国不断加剧的威胁,包括经济胁迫、贸易战升级,以及对我们主权的公开质疑。全球范围内,经济民族主义正在抬头,供应链逐渐被工具化,安全联盟也在重新调整。在这样的环境下,我们不仅面临着经济上的考验,更是承受着心理上的重压。

For months, Canada has been under escalating pressure from the United States — economic threats, trade uncertainty, and rhetoric that openly questions our sovereignty. Economic nationalism is rising globally. Supply chains are being weaponized. Security alliances are being recalibrated. We are being tested not just economically, but psychologically.

在面对一个强势且难以预测的美国时,沉稳与能力自然会成为凝聚力的来源。许多国家在这种压力下会选择退让,但加拿大却站稳了立场。

When navigating a more aggressive and unpredictable United States, competence becomes magnetic. Smaller countries often bend under such pressure. But Canada has not bent.

能做到这一点绝非偶然。

That did not happen by accident.

马克·卡尼就任与危机关头,他并不高喊口号,而是以制度与纪律应对挑战。他将加拿大定位为一个拥有主权意识与经济实力的国家,而非被动应对的邻国,并在此基础上推动贸易多元化,巩固多边经济伙伴关系。他不仅巧用美国政府所理解的经济市场策略,更重要的是,他在整个过程中保持相当的克制,而非哗众取宠,诉诸政治表演。

Since taking office, Mark Carney has approached the crisis not with slogans, but with discipline. He has strengthened trade diversification efforts, reinforced alliances, and framed Canada not as a reactive neighbour but as a sovereign economic power. He has spoken the language of markets and institutions — language Washington understands. More importantly, he has done so without theatrics.

在外部压力面前,真正的领导力取决于三项能力:沉稳可信、战略清晰,以及赢得国际尊重。

卡尼正具备这三项条件。

Leadership during external pressure requires three things: calm credibility, strategic clarity, and international respect.

Carney possesses all three.

在这样的背景下保守党议员的跳槽之举就不难理解。他们并非无足轻重的后座议员,也不是为了头衔而为之的政治新人。他们是民选代表,来自自由党长期以来根基不稳的地区。跨越党派并非没有代价,这意味着承受来自旧有盟友的批评,也可能影响未来的党内提名与政治前途。

The decision by Conservative MPs to cross the floor should be understood in that light. These are not backbench rookies chasing titles. They are elected officials who represent constituents in provinces where Liberal support has historically been thin. Crossing the floor carries political risk. It invites criticism from former allies. It jeopardizes future nomination battles.

为什么要承担政治风险而做出跳槽之举?

Why take that risk?

因为在国家面临挑战和压力之际,领导力比党派立场更为重要。

Because leadership matters more than partisanship when the country is under strain.

最近跨越党派阵营的阿尔伯塔省议员马特·詹鲁在其社交媒体发布的信中写道: “加拿大目前最需要的是稳健的领导力,全体议员之间建设性的合作、以及艰难险阻面前敢挑重担的意愿。”

“For Canada, this is a moment that demands steady leadership, constructive collaboration between all Parliamentarians, and a willingness to stand up and serve even when the path is not easy,” Alberta MP Matt Jeneroux, the latest party crosser, wrote in a letter posted to his social media accounts.

这并非偶然。近几个月来,加拿大在国际上的地位明显稳固,盟友将渥太华视为可靠的伙伴,金融市场认可其政策规范,贸易伙伴则欣赏其稳定与可预期性。

It is no coincidence that this shift is happening now. Canada’s position internationally has strengthened in recent months. Our allies view Ottawa as stable. Financial markets view Canada as disciplined. Trade partners see predictability.

批评者会说,选民当初是以保守党身份选出这些政治跳槽者的,的确如此。但选民选出的,是能够作出正确判断的议会代表,而不仅是党派标签。议会民主并非僵化的忠诚制度,它允许在形势变化时重新衡量立场。当逆风来袭时,加国选民们更需要的是对掌舵者的信任。

Critics will argue that voters elected these MPs as Conservatives. That is true. But voters elect representatives not merely to wear a party label, but to exercise judgment. Parliamentary democracy is not a system of robotic loyalty; it allows elected officials to reassess when circumstances change. And when a country faces headwinds, it requires confidence in the person steering the ship.

这三名代表各自选区的议员相信,当前的掌舵者足以带领加拿大穿越风暴。

Three MPs, representing tens of thousands of Canadians, have decided that the current captain is steady enough for the storm.

这并非背叛。

That is not betrayal.

而是政治格局的必然。.

That is political gravity.
